FCC Rules for Inmate Calling ServicesThe FCC is asking for comments on various “ancillary” fees collected by inmate calling service (ICS) providers. Ancillary fees include fees for account setup, account replenishment, account refund, and account inactivity fees. Comments are due July 17, 2013; reply comments are due July 24, 2013. The FCC also provided notice that certain readily-available information about ICS contracts and U.S. Census data may be considered in the proceeding.

 

Background

In December 2012, the FCC asked if it should revise its rules to ensure just and reasonable inmate calling services rates for interstate, long distance calling at correctional facilities.
